The GUHRING 9007320038000 is a solid carbide jobber-length drill bit in wire gauge size 25, with a decimal diameter of 0.1496 inches. It features a 118-degree faceted point angle and a two-flute regular spiral geometry with web thinning for improved chip evacuation and reduced thrust at entry. The overall length is 75 mm with a 43 mm flute length and a straight-cylindrical shank diameter of 3.80 mm. Finished bright and uncoated, this bit is manufactured to DIN specification with an h8 diameter tolerance. It is suited for general-purpose drilling operations performed by machinists, tool-and-die technicians, and maintenance professionals.
This drill bit is designed primarily for use in aluminum and other non-ferrous materials classified under material code N. Its 5xD flute-to-diameter ratio and web-thinned point make it effective in both manual drill press and CNC machining center applications where consistent hole geometry and diameter tolerance are required. A maximum drilling depth of 37.30 mm (1.469 inches) suits typical through-hole and blind-hole work in light-metal components. This bit ships as a single unit and is part of the GUHRING Series 732 line of solid carbide jobber drills.

Installation and use should be performed by qualified machinists or tooling professionals familiar with carbide tooling procedures. Secure the shank fully in a properly sized collet or drill chuck before operation and verify runout before cutting. Carbide tooling is brittle - avoid side loading, interrupted cuts without appropriate feed adjustments, or dropping the bit on hard surfaces. Consult machine manufacturer feed and speed guidelines for the workpiece material before use.
